How can I hide data in column for specific colleagues with editors role?

For example, my table have columns A, B, C, D I want that editors can view and edit A, B,C columns But column D will be hide for them

And only I as a creator can view and edit data in column D

Best answer by ScottWorld

Airtable doesn’t offer the ability to hide any fields from collaborators. (You can hide them on a particular view, but they could just go to another view to see those fields.)

You would need to use an external portal tool like MiniExtensions.com to accomplish that.
